Actualizar las políticas de control de funcionalidad para el proyecto.
Las Políticas de Control de funcionalidades permiten habilitar o deshabilitar ciertas funcionalidades de MongoDB según las necesidades específicas del sitio.
Sintaxis
mongocli ops-manager featurePolicies update [options]
opciones
Nombre | Tipo | Requerido | Descripción |
|---|---|---|---|
-f, --file | string | false | Nombre de archivo que identifica un archivo opcional con una configuración de política JSON. |
-h, --help | false | ayuda para actualizar | |
--name | string | false | Etiqueta identificadora para el sistema externo que gestiona este Proyecto de Ops Manager. |
-o, --output | string | false | Formato de salida. Los valores válidos son json, json-path, go-template o go-template-file. Para ver la salida completa, use la opción -o json. |
--policy | Cuerdas | false | Lista de políticas que el sistema externo aplica a este proyecto de Ops Manager. Al habilitar esta función se sobrescriben los datos preexistentes. |
--projectId | string | false | string hexadecimal que identifica el Proyecto a utilizar. Esta opción anula la configuración en el archivo de configuración o la variable de entorno. |
--systemId | string | false | Identificador único del sistema externo que gestiona este proyecto de Ops Manager. |
Opciones heredadas
Nombre | Tipo | Requerido | Descripción |
|---|---|---|---|
-P, --profile | string | false | Nombre del perfil que se usará del archivo de configuración. Para aprender más sobre los perfiles para MongoCLI, consulta https://dochub.mongodb.org/core/atlas-cli-configuration-file. |
Ejemplos
# Disable user management for a project: mongocli ops-manager featurePolicies update --projectId <projectId> --name Operator --policy DISABLE_USER_MANAGEMENT
# Update policies from a JSON configuration file: mongocli atlas featurePolicies update --projectId <projectId> --file <path/to/file.json>